SB 18 Hawaii Senate · 2026 Regular Session

RELATING TO HISTORIC PRESERVATION.

Summary
Appropriate funds into and out of the Hawaii Historic Preservation Special Fund for the State Historic Preservation Division to inventory historic properties and burial sites in the State, collect data on burial site locations, and conduct an archaeological survey necessary to compile the inventory. Effective 7/1/2050. (SD1)

What changed between versions

SB18 SB18_SD1 · 3 edits
MINOR
The bill was updated from a House version (HB) to a Senate version (SD), changing the bill number and associated metadata. The most significant substantive change is the effective date of the Act, which was moved from July 1, 2025, to July 1, 2050, likely indicating a placeholder or a significant delay in implementation. Minor formatting and capitalization adjustments were also made to the title and section headers.
Scope change
The bill's scope regarding historic preservation funding and inventory requirements remains unchanged, but the timeline for implementation has been drastically extended.
TIMELINE

The effective date of the Act was changed from July 1, 2025, to July 1, 2050.

TECHNICAL

The bill identifier was updated from SB18 to SB18 SD1, and metadata such as revision numbers and template types were updated to reflect the Senate version.

Minor capitalization changes were made to the title and section headers for consistency.
